Having been enticed into the industry 30 years ago after a chance meeting in Brighton, Newbury-born Jason spent years perfecting his unique style at salons across West Berkshire and London. It was at one of the capital’s most prestigious West End salons that he was able to push himself even further and learn the intricate skills of precision cutting that would go on to set his salon apart on his return to Newbury in 2005. “We offer precision cutting at a very high standard,” he explains. “It comes from a unique way of dry cutting, which is very architectural. Every layer should sit perfectly on the next. “It has become a very specialist skill that not many stylists are able to offer as it has been passed down through specific generations of cutters from Leonard’s of London, to John Freida, to Nicky Clarke and his brother Michael Van Clarke, and then to myself and Joseph, who has worked as a senior stylist at the salon since 2006. “It is about dry cutting clean hair sectioned in a specific
